This callback is mandatory for VFIO_DEVICE_FEATURE_MIGRATION support. The function pointer for this callback is specified via the 'migration_set_state' field of the 'vfio_migration_ops' structure which is stored with the VFIO device when the 'vfio_device' structure representing the mediated device is initialized. * The callback that returns the current vfio device migration state during live migration of guests with pass-through access to AP devices. The function pointer for this callback is specified via the 'migration_get_state' field of the 'vfio_migration_ops' structure which is stored with the VFIO device when the 'vfio_device' structure representing the mediated device is initialized.
